Online Sportsbook BetOnline released updated Heisman Trophy odds for the 2020 season which included LSU cornerback Derek Stingley Jr., quarterback Myles Brennan, and wide receiver Ja'Marr Chase.

Derek Stingley Jr. - 16/1
Myles Brennan - 16/1
Ja'Marr Chase - 20/1

Justin Jefferson also received odds (20/1) but he is headed to the NFL Draft.
